Thessaly, Larissa. Drachm circa 380-365, AR 5.98 g. Head of the nymph Larissa facing slightly l., wearing wreath of grain ears and necklace. Rev. Thessalian warrior galloping r., wearing tunic, chlamys, and petasos, holding lance. L-S Series 5, Dies O1/R1. BCD Thessaly II, 292 (this obverse die). cf. Leu 81, lot 190 = Leu 42, lot 210 (these dies)
Light tone; work of a very skilled master engraver; Surfaces
somewhat porous, otherwise about extremely fine

Ex Triton sale XVI, 2013, 338. From the BCD collection.
